UCI’s Alcantara, Kreuter on All-Big West baseball first team

UC Irvine junior Adam Alcantara and sophomore Cole Kreuter have been named first-team All-Big West Conference in baseball.

UCI senior Elliott Surrey, Cal State Fullerton sophomore Connor Seabold and Cal State Fullerton junior Scott Serigstad are area standouts who are second-team honorees.

Alcantara, an outfielder, finished the season on a 16-game hitting streak and hit .393 in Big West games. He drove in 19 runs during conference play.

Alcantara hit .337 overall with two home runs, 36 RBIs and five stolen bases.

Kreuter, a second baseman, hit .284 overall with one homer, 26 RBIs, 31 runs and four stolen bases.

Against Big West pitching, Kreuter hit .282 with 11 RBIs and 11 runs in 24 games.

Surrey, the Anteaters’ No. 1 starting pitcher, finished 4-6 with a 3.65 earned-run average. In eight conference starts, he was 2-5 with a 4.29 ERA.

Surrey’s two conference wins were complete games against Cal State Fullerton and Cal State Northridge. Against Fullerton, Surrey posted a five-hit shutout in which he struck out seven. Against Cal State Northridge, he surrendered three hits and one run, while striking out 10, which matched his season best.

Seabold, a Newport Harbor High product and a weekend starting pitcher for the conference champion Titans, is 7-5 with a 2.42 ERA heading into the NCAA Regional.

In eight conference starts, he was 5-3 with a 2.05 ERA, with 54 strikeouts and only three walks in 48 1/3 innings.

Serigstad, part of Orange Coast College’s state championship team in 2015, leads the Titans with four saves, all in conference play.

Serigstad was 1-1 in conference, his only two decisions, and posted an 0.83 ERA in 21 2/3 conference innings. Overall, he has a 1.13 ERA with 53 strikeouts in 47 2/3 innings.

UCI senior first baseman Mitchell Holland received honorable mention. He hit .322 with one homer and 12 RBIs in 24 conference games, and hit .300 with two homers and 32 RBIs overall.

UCI finished 31-15, 11-13 in conference, tied for seventh place.

Cal State Fullerton senior outfielder Dalton Blaser is the Field Player of the Year, while Long Beach State sophomore Darren McCaughnan is the Pitcher of the Year.

Cal State Fullerton’s Rick Vanderhook is the Coach of the Year.
